كتيبات سطر الأوامر

Man » دليل basename عبر الإنترنت - وثائق مفصلة عبر الإنترنت لصفحة رجل basename

🌍
basename - يزيل المجلد واللاحقة من أسماء الملفات

الملخص

basename NAME [SUFFIX]
basename OPTION... NAME...

الوصف

يطبع الاسم NAME مع إزالة أي مكونات مجلد بادئة. إذا تم تحديده، فإنه يزيل أيضًا اللاحقة اللاحقة.

الحجج الإلزامية للخيارات الطويلة إلزامية للخيارات القصيرة أيضًا.

-a, --multiple
يدعم حجج متعددة ويعامل كل منها كـ NAME

-s, --suffix=SUFFIX
يزيل اللاحقة اللاحقة؛ يعني -a

-z, --zero
ينهي كل سطر إخراج بـ NUL، وليس سطرًا جديدًا

--help عرض هذه المساعدة والخروج

--version
إخراج معلومات الإصدار والخروج

أمثلة

basename /usr/bin/sort
-> "sort"

basename include/stdio.h .h
-> "stdio"

basename -s .h include/stdio.h
-> "stdio"

basename -a any/str1 any/str2
-> "str1" متبوعًا بـ "str2"

المؤلف

كتبه ديفيد ماكنزي.

الإبلاغ عن الأخطاء

مساعدة GNU coreutils عبر الإنترنت: [https://www.gnu.org/software/coreutils/] أبلغ عن أي أخطاء ترجمة إلى [https://translationproject.org/team/]

انظر أيضًا

dirname(1)، readlink(1)

وثائق كاملة [https://www.gnu.org/software/coreutils/basename] أو متوفرة محليًا عبر: info '(coreutils) basename invocation'

تم التعبئة بواسطة Debian (9.7-3) حقوق الطبع والنشر © 2025 مؤسسة البرمجيات الحرة، Inc. الترخيص GPLv3+: GNU GPL الإصدار 3 أو أحدث [https://gnu.org/licenses/gpl.html]. هذا برنامج مجاني: أنت حر في تغيير وإعادة توزيعه. لا توجد ضمانات، إلى الحد الذي يسمح به القانون.